Course Content

• Introduction to Climate Change Science and Impacts
• The UNFCCC and its Mechanisms: Kyoto Protocol & Paris Agreement
• Climate Change Negotiation Fundamentals: Principles, Processes, and Actors
• Diplomacy Skills for Climate Change Negotiations: Communication, Persuasion, and Coalition Building
• Financing Climate Action: Green Climate Fund & Climate Finance Mechanisms
• National Determined Contributions (NDCs) and their Implementation
• Loss and Damage Mechanisms in Climate Negotiations
• Climate Change Adaptation and Mitigation Strategies
• Conflict Resolution and Negotiation Techniques in Climate Diplomacy
• Climate Change Negotiation and Diplomacy Case Studies: Successes and Failures

Career path

Career Role Description
Climate Change Negotiator (Climate Diplomacy, International Relations) Representing governments or organizations in international climate negotiations, advocating for policy changes. High demand due to increasing global climate action.
Sustainability Consultant (Environmental Policy, Climate Change Mitigation) Advising businesses and organizations on reducing their carbon footprint and achieving sustainability goals. Growing sector with diverse opportunities.
Climate Policy Analyst (Climate Change Adaptation, Policy Analysis) Analyzing climate change policies and their impacts, providing evidence-based recommendations for policy improvement. Essential role in effective climate governance.
Renewable Energy Policy Officer (Renewable Energy, Energy Transition) Developing and implementing policies to support the transition to renewable energy sources. Crucial for achieving net-zero targets.
